NBRI has a bunch of holdings in Canada & the USofA but the Ruby Goldmine in the Calif GoldCountry is their primary target right now. Ruby is quite unique in that it is 'primarilly an underground placer mine encasing a pre-historic riverbed...loaded with monster nuggets...it also contains some hardrock ore deposits. This historic mine has a lenghty history of proven reserves (see pictures in their iBox). The section these nuggets were mined out of is still largely untapped because the government forcefully shut them down during the 2nd WorldWar & the price of gold was limited to $35/oz for many years after the war....making it not worth their while to re-open it regardless of the known wealth it contained. Many years later, another operator started to re-open it when gold went back up...they got all the infra-structure in-place [mill,lighting,shoring,ventilation etc] only to run onto hard times from some ancillary problem I'm not to clear on. In any case , they now have a new (qualified) owner & have all required permits & most of their funding in-place. They are in the process of re-opening the mine...dbl-checking all the infra-structure for safety & function & completing a few needed improvements before gearing-up.
